General Conditions of Sale for Key Account Customers
(Effective from 1 January 2025)
1. Purpose and Scope
These General Conditions of Sale (“Conditions”) apply to all orders placed with Destiny Foods (the “Company”) by key account customers whose supply arrangements are centralised.
Placing an order constitutes full and unconditional acceptance of these Conditions. Any updated version replaces the previous version upon publication. Any variation must be expressly agreed by the Company in writing.
2. Intellectual Property and Confidentiality
The customer acknowledges that the Company owns or has exclusive rights over its brands, logos, trade names, packaging, designs, and product recipes. The customer must not use, register, or imitate these rights without prior written consent.
All intellectual property, including manufacturing and packaging processes, remains the exclusive property of the Company.

9. Force Majeure
The Company is not liable for failure to perform obligations caused by events beyond its reasonable control, including strikes, transport disruption, accidents, equipment breakdowns, supply shortages, adverse weather, or public health emergencies.
Where such events occur, the Company will notify the customer as soon as possible. Obligations are suspended for the duration of the event without liability.

13. Ethics and Compliance
The Company is committed to ethical and sustainable business practices, including respect for human rights, labour standards, environmental protection, and anti-corruption, in line with the principles of the UN Global Compact.
Customers must comply with all applicable anti-bribery, anti-corruption, and money laundering laws. Any breach entitles the Company to terminate the commercial relationship with immediate effect.
14. Severability
If any provision of these Conditions is found invalid or unenforceable, the remainder shall continue in full force and effect.
15. Waiver
Failure to enforce any provision shall not be construed as a waiver of that provision or any other rights.
